import sys
sys.path.append("../tools/")
import pickle
from sklearn.svm import LinearSVC
from sklearn.tree import DecisionTreeClassifier
from sklearn.ensemble import AdaBoostClassifier
from sklearn.ensemble import RandomForestClassifier
from sklearn.linear_model import LogisticRegression
from sklearn.model_selection import GridSearchCV
from sklearn.metrics import recall_score, precision_score, f1_score, accuracy_score
from sklearn.decomposition import PCA
from sklearn.pipeline import Pipeline
import matplotlib.pyplot as plt
from tester import test_classifier
## Function to get a particular value out of dictionary of dictionaries
def dict_values(dict, item):
new_list = []
for name in dict:
new_list.append(dict[name][item]) if not isinstance(dict[name][item], str) \
else new_list.append(0)
return new_list
## Data load and pre-process
def data_load_process():
# Load the dictionary containing the data set
with open("final_project_dataset.pkl", "r") as data_file:
data_dict = pickle.load(data_file)
# visualizing data
print len(data_dict)
salary = dict_values(data_dict, 'salary')
bonus = dict_values(data_dict, 'bonus')
plt.scatter(salary, bonus)
plt.title('Salary vs bonus')
plt.ylabel('bonus ')
plt.xlabel('salary')
plt.show()
# Removing outliers and re-visualizing
# From scatter plot above we find 'TOTAL' to be an outlier
outliers = ['TOTAL']
# checking for more outliers
outliers.append('THE TRAVEL AGENCY IN THE PARK')
# checking for all missing data for an entry
for name in data_dict:
flag = 0
for item in data_dict[name]:
if data_dict[name][item] != 'NaN':
if item != 'poi':
flag = 1
if flag == 0:
outliers.append(name)
# removing outliers
for outlier in outliers:
data_dict.pop(outlier, 0)
#print data_dict
salary = dict_values(data_dict, 'salary')
bonus = dict_values(data_dict, 'bonus')
poi = dict_values(data_dict, 'poi')
plt.scatter(salary, bonus, s = 100, c = poi)
plt.title('Salary vs bonus after removing outlier')
plt.ylabel('bonus ')
plt.xlabel('salary')
plt.show()
poi_count = 0
for person in data_dict:
if data_dict[person]['poi']:
poi_count = poi_count + 1
print 'POI count = {}'.format(poi_count)
print 'NON-POI count = {}'.format(len(data_dict) - poi_count)
return data_dict
## looking at features
def look_at_features(data_dict):
features = data_dict['METTS MARK'].keys()
print 'The features present are: {}'.format(features)
print 'Total no of features = {}'.format(len(features))
feature_list = dict()
for feature in features:
feature_list[feature] = 0
for name in data_dict:
if data_dict[name][feature] == 'NaN':
feature_list[feature] = feature_list[feature] + 1
features_list = sorted(feature_list.items(), key = lambda x:x[1], reverse=True)
print features_list
return 0
## Create new feature(s)
def add_new_features(features_list, data_dict):
new_features = ['ratio_of_to_poi_messages',
'ratio_of_from_poi_messages',
'total_poi_messages',
'salary_square',
'bonus_square',
'total_stock_value_square',
'incentive_cube',
'bonus_salary_ratio']
features_list = features_list + new_features
for name in data_dict:
# To make all non numeric values into numeric
if isinstance(data_dict[name]['from_this_person_to_poi'], str):
data_dict[name]['from_this_person_to_poi'] = 0
if isinstance(data_dict[name]['to_messages'],str):
data_dict[name]['to_messages'] = 0
if isinstance(data_dict[name]['from_poi_to_this_person'], str):
data_dict[name]['from_poi_to_this_person'] = 0
if isinstance(data_dict[name]['from_messages'], str):
data_dict[name]['from_messages'] = 0
# Creating ratio_of_to_poi_messages
# try/except is to ensure that infinite values get dealt with correctly
try:
ratio_of_to_poi_messages = float(data_dict[name]['from_this_person_to_poi']) /\
float(data_dict[name]['from_messages'])
except:
ratio_of_to_poi_messages = 0
# Creating ratio_of_from_poi_messages
# try/except is to ensure that infinite values get dealt with correctly
try:
ratio_of_from_poi_messages = float(data_dict[name]['from_poi_to_this_person']) /\
float(data_dict[name]['to_messages'])
except:
ratio_of_from_poi_messages = 0
# Creating total_poi_messages
data_dict[name]['total_poi_messages'] = data_dict[name]['from_this_person_to_poi'] +\
data_dict[name]['from_poi_to_this_person']
# Inserting the new features into the dictionary
data_dict[name]['ratio_of_to_poi_messages'] = ratio_of_to_poi_messages
data_dict[name]['ratio_of_from_poi_messages'] = ratio_of_from_poi_messages
if(data_dict[name]['salary'] != 'NaN'):
data_dict[name]['salary_square'] = data_dict[name]['salary'] ** 2
else:
data_dict[name]['salary_square'] = 0
if (data_dict[name]['bonus'] != 'NaN'):
data_dict[name]['bonus_square'] = data_dict[name]['bonus'] ** 2
else:
data_dict[name]['bonus_square'] = 0
if (data_dict[name]['total_stock_value'] != 'NaN' and data_dict[name]['total_stock_value'] > 0):
data_dict[name]['total_stock_value_square'] = data_dict[name]['total_stock_value'] ** 2
else:
data_dict[name]['total_stock_value_square'] = 0
if (data_dict[name]['long_term_incentive'] != 'NaN' and data_dict[name]['long_term_incentive'] > 0):
data_dict[name]['incentive_square'] = data_dict[name]['long_term_incentive'] ** 2
else:
data_dict[name]['incentive_square'] = 0
if (data_dict[name]['long_term_incentive'] != 'NaN' and data_dict[name]['long_term_incentive'] > 0):
data_dict[name]['incentive_cube'] = data_dict[name]['long_term_incentive'] ** 3
else:
data_dict[name]['incentive_cube'] = 0
if (data_dict[name]['salary'] != 'NaN' and data_dict[name]['bonus'] != 'NaN'):
data_dict[name]['bonus_salary_ratio'] = data_dict[name]['bonus'] / data_dict[name]['salary']
else:
data_dict[name]['bonus_salary_ratio'] = 0
return features_list, data_dict
## Adding all the classifier functions
def classifier_list():
clf_list = []
# NAIVE BAYES
#from sklearn.naive_bayes import GaussianNB
#clf_NB = GaussianNB()
#clf_NB_params = {}
#clf_list.append((clf_NB, clf_NB_params))
# DECISION TREE
clf_tree = DecisionTreeClassifier()
clf_tree_params = {"min_samples_split": [2,5,10],
"criterion": ["gini", "entropy"],
"random_state": [47]}
clf_list.append((clf_tree, clf_tree_params))
# LOGISTIC REGRESSION
clf_logreg = LogisticRegression()
clf_logreg_params = {"C": [0.05, 0.5, 1, 10, 10**2,10**5,10**10, 10**20],
"tol": [10**-1, 10**-5, 10**-10],
"random_state": [47]}
clf_list.append((clf_logreg, clf_logreg_params))
# ADABOOST
clf_ada = AdaBoostClassifier()
clf_ada_params = {"n_estimators": [20, 30, 40, 50],
#"learning_rate": [0.1, 0.5, 1, 2, 5],
"algorithm": ["SAMME", "SAMME.R"],
"random_state": [47]}
clf_list.append((clf_ada, clf_ada_params))
# RANDOM FOREST
clf_rforest = RandomForestClassifier()
clf_rforest_params = {"n_estimators": [20, 30, 40, 50],
"criterion": ["gini", "entropy"],
"min_samples_split": [2, 5, 10],
"random_state": [47]}
clf_list.append((clf_rforest, clf_rforest_params))
# SVM
clf_svm = LinearSVC()
clf_svm_params = {"C": [1, 5, 10, 15, 20],
"tol": [0.1, 0.01, 0.001, 0.0001],
"dual": [False],
"random_state" : [47]}
clf_list.append((clf_svm, clf_svm_params))
""""""
return clf_list
## Using pipeline to add PCA to all classifiers. Also updating the parameter list
def add_pca(clf_list):
pca = PCA()
pca_params = {'pca__n_components': [5, 10, 15, 20],
"pca__random_state": [47]}
delimiter = '('
clf_list_new = []
for classifier in clf_list:
clf, params = classifier
name = str(clf).split(delimiter)
new_param = {}
for param, values in params.iteritems():
new_param[name[0] + '__' + param] = values
clf_pipeline = Pipeline([('pca', pca), (name[0], clf)])
#print clf_pipeline
new_param.update(pca_params)
#print new_param
clf_list_new.append((clf_pipeline, new_param))
return clf_list_new
## Applying GridSearch to the classifier list to select best parameters
def classify(clf_list, features_train, labels_train):
best_clf_list = []
for classifier, params in clf_list:
clf_rev = GridSearchCV(classifier, params)
clf_rev.fit(features_train, labels_train)
try:
best_clf_list.append(clf_rev.best_estimator_)
except:
print "no best estimator available for this classifier"
return best_clf_list
## Function to evaluate the accuracy, recall and precision of the classifiers
def evaluate(clf_list, features_test, labels_test):
new_list = []
for clf in clf_list:
pred = clf.predict(features_test)
recall = recall_score(labels_test, pred)
precision = precision_score(labels_test, pred)
f1 = f1_score(labels_test, pred)
acc = accuracy_score(labels_test, pred)
new_list.append((clf, recall, precision, acc, f1))
return new_list
## using tester to determine classifier
def evaluate2(clf_list, my_dataset, features_list):
for clf in clf_list:
test_classifier(clf, my_dataset, features_list)
return 1
### Sort the classifier list according to their f1-score
def sort_clf(clf_list):
clf_list_sorted = sorted(clf_list, key = lambda x:x[1], reverse=True)
return clf_list_sorted
### Best classifier tuning
def best_classifier():
clf = []
clf_tree = DecisionTreeClassifier()
clf_tree_params = {"min_samples_split": [2, 5, 10],
"criterion": ["gini", "entropy"],
"random_state": [46]}
clf.append((clf_tree, clf_tree_params))
return clf
